For the Necromancer to be able to successfully cast spells involving Bone, Blood, and Shadow, the primary resource that they need to have access to is Essence.  These spells can be used either offensively or defensively, depending on the context in which they are cast.  This class grants you access to the one-of-a-kind Book of the Dead mechanic, which enables you to further personalize your army of the undead to fit your preferences in a more precise manner.  When a player uses the Dismount ability that is associated with the class of their character, they will be thrown off of their mount and land on the ground below.  This ability is class-specific.  Bone Magic's destructive power is unleashed in the form of a cone that deals damage to all nearby enemies.  This cone deals damage in a cone-shaped area.

Necromancer Edition of Diablo 4's Book of the Dead expansion.  Each of the Skeletal summons that the Necromancer uses will have two upgrades applied to Diablo 4 Runes, both of which will improve the primary combat speciality that the summon already possesses.  These upgrades will be applied by the Necromancer.  These enhancements are sold by the Necromancer, who is also the only source from which one can purchase them.  For example, the Cold Skeletal Mage will have upgrades that will give you Essence whenever any of your opponents take damage, and its second upgrade will make opponents who are attacked while frozen vulnerable for a brief period.  Another example is the Frost Mage, which will have upgrades that will grant you Essence whenever any of your opponents take damage.  The Cold Skeletal Mage located in the dungeon is your best bet for acquiring either of these two upgrades.
